Latest Patents

One of Paul Nance's notable patents is the "Method and timing circuit for generating a switching or control signal." This invention describes a sophisticated method for generating a control signal following a predetermined period. It involves applying a voltage to an inductor at the start of a time measurement and outputting the control signal via a current threshold value detector when the current through the inductor exceeds a certain threshold. Additionally, he holds a patent for a "Circuit configuration for driving an ignition coil." This configuration consists of a primary winding connected in series with a first semiconductor switch, with a control electrode that operates based on a specific drive signal, as well as a second semiconductor switch operating in parallel.
